Maximum capacity of dispersion tube:
• 1½" dia. (DN40): 56.8 lbs/hr
(25.8 kg/h)
• 2" dia. (DN50): 85.2 lbs/hr
(38.6 kg/h)
Condensate drain tube, by installer, ¾" DN20 minimum. Return line piping material must
be suitable for 212 °F (100 °C) water. Note: Condensate may be returned to the humidifier
or wasted to a drain. See the previous page for piping condensate to a drain.
Notes:
1 Assemble multiple dispersion tubes or use a Rapid-sorb or Ultra-sorb dispersion
assembly where necessary to accommodate maximum humidifier load.
2 The smallest GTS humidifier steam outlet is 2" (DN50). Install an adaptor manifold
if using multiple 1½" (DN40) dispersion tubes. See also Table 37-1.
3 Pitch vapor hose, tubing or pipe toward humidifier:
– 2"/ft (15%) when using vapor hose
– ½"/ft (5%) when using 1½" (DN40) tubing or pipe
– ¼"/ft (2%) when using 2" (DN50) tubing or pipe
4 Dashed lines indicate provided by installer
